The recent news of heightened alert levels across US embassies and military bases in the Middle East due to fears of an impending Israeli strike on Iran is a cause for concern. This development comes amidst growing tensions between Israel, Iran, and the United States, which have been escalating over the past few years.
Historically, the relationship between these three nations has been fraught with conflict. The US has long been an ally of Israel, while Iran is considered a hostile nation due to its nuclear ambitions and support for various terrorist groups in the region. This complex web of alliances and enmities has led to several conflicts over the years, including the Iraq War and the ongoing Syrian Civil War.
The potential implications of an Israeli strike on Iran are significant. Such a move could lead to widespread instability in the Middle East, with repercussions felt far beyond the region. It may also escalate tensions between Israel and its neighbors, potentially leading to further conflict or even war. Additionally, it would likely strain relations between the US and Iran, making diplomatic efforts to resolve ongoing disputes more difficult.
From a strategic standpoint, reducing the US presence in the Middle East is a prudent move given these heightened tensions. By withdrawing some of its forces from the region, the US can minimize potential casualties should hostilities break out between Israel and Iran. Furthermore, this action sends a clear message to both parties that it does not wish to be drawn into another costly war in the Middle East.
In conclusion, while the reduction of the U.S.’s presence in the Middle East is undoubtedly concerning, it appears to be a necessary step given the current state of affairs between Israel and Iran.
